Abstract

The present invention provides a kind of internal car noise test bad road and its laying method, internal car noise method of testing, wherein, internal car noise test bad road includes the surface layer that thickness is 120 millimeters, and the surface layer is included by weight 2:1 ratio is mixed, particle diameter is respectively to be filled with modified pitch between the building stones of 25 millimeters and 20 millimeters, the building stones.The present invention designs and the road surface parameter on bad road is determined, increase and perfect test road surface, by testing internal car noise on bad road, for reduction internal car noise provides it is a kind of test and evaluation of programme, improve vehicle level of NVH, make properties of product more competitive.

Background technology
Vehicle Interior Noise is typically influenceed larger by the roughness of road surface structure, and automobile is with identical speed in roughness Travelled on different roads, internal car noise and speech intelligibility are all different.When automobile with medium speed in motion, usual car Interior noise is made an uproar essentially from tire and wind, if travelled on more coarse cement road, in addition to tire is made an uproar and made an uproar with wind, is also had The low-frequency noise produced is encouraged to vehicle from road surface.Most of automobiles have the problem of low-frequency noise is big, in order to preferably grind The problem is studied carefully, in auto NVH(Noise, Vibration, Harshness, noise, vibration and comfortableness)It is bad in development process Road noise testing is to examine one of method of internal car noise, and vehicle travels hour wheel tire on bad road and encouraged by road surface, causes The increase of in-car low-frequency noise, passes through the internal car noise on test bad road, it can be deduced that the internal car noise level on bad road and frequency into Point.
At present inside major proving grounds in addition to performance road, other road surfaces are not suitable for carrying out automobile noise test, such as The pavement strengths such as Belgian road, washboard road and resonance road are larger, are mainly used to test vehicle durability, it is impossible to test out well The noise level of vehicle;And performance road is more smooth, it is adapted to development wind and makes an uproar and accelerate internal car noise to test, but can not fully encourage In-car low-frequency noise.Therefore, internal car noise is studied, it is necessary to a surface roughness be designed than coarse road greatly, than resistance in order to comprehensive Long road(Such as washboard road, road paved with oval stones)Small road, to carry out internal car noise test on this basis.

Embodiment
Below with reference to the accompanying drawings the preferred embodiments of the present invention are described.
It refer to shown in Fig. 1, the embodiment of the present invention one provides a kind of internal car noise test bad road, including thickness is 120 millis The surface layer 1 of rice, the surface layer is included by weight 2:1 ratio mixing, particle diameter be respectively 25 millimeters and 20 millimeters building stones 11, 12, modified pitch 13 is filled between building stones.Specifically, the particle diameter of building stones 11 is 25 millimeters, and the particle diameter of building stones 12 is 20 millimeters, stone The weight ratio of material 11 and building stones 12 is 2:1.
The voidage of the surface layer 1 is 8.5%, and construction depth is 10.24 millimeters.In addition, considering laying cost and test Convenient, the test road surfacing width of the present embodiment is 3 meters, and laying length is 80 ~ 100 meters, preferably 100 meters.
The constituent of internal car noise and the relation of speed are:Low speed main contributions come from power assembly, during medium speed Made an uproar essentially from tire, wind is made an uproar and body structure low-frequency noise, be mainly tire during high speed and make an uproar and made an uproar with wind.Exist in view of vehicle GB18697-2002(In-car at the uniform velocity noise testing standard, is one and is specifically used to measure in-car when specification passenger car is at the uniform velocity travelled The national standard of noise, the standard provides to measure the side of internal car noise when vehicle is at the uniform velocity travelled with different speeds in smooth road Method, content includes test condition, measuring point, measurement condition, measuring process and data processing method etc.)On defined smooth road in When being travelled etc. speed, it is impossible to well encourage in-car low-frequency noise, the internal car noise test bad road that the present embodiment is provided, Employed on the construction of surface layer by particle diameter be respectively 25 millimeters and 20 millimeters building stones, by weight 2:1 ratio is mixed, so that shape Into so-called " bad road ", its roughness is between coarse road and durable road.When vehicle is with middle low speed(Such as 40km/h)At the uniform velocity exist Travelled on this bad road, can just evoke the construct noise within in-car low-frequency noise, particularly 200Hz.By testing this bad road Under internal car noise, analyzed with reference to the structural frequency response of vehicle chassis, can be very good to determine noise source, and for rectification scheme There is provided and instruct with examining.
As can be seen here, present invention increase and perfect test road surface, by the test road surface constructed by the present embodiment Internal car noise is tested, a kind of test and evaluation of programme is provided for reduction internal car noise, improves vehicle level of NVH, make product Can be more competitive.
Compared with other existing test road surfaces, the test bad road of the present embodiment is mainly improved as the most upper of pavement structure The surface layer 1 of layer(The work repeatedly of pull of vacuum produced by after its vertical force for directly bearing traffic load, horizontal force and vehicle body With while being influenceed by rainfall and temperature Change)Construction, as an example, refer to shown in Fig. 2, the survey of the present embodiment Shi Huai roads also include successively from bottom to top:
Soil matrix 2, by heavy standard compaction, compactness >=95%;
Underlayment 3, the thick rubble by particle diameter at 5-15 centimetres is constituted, and the thickness of underlayment is 60 centimetres;
The GSZ 4 at the top of underlayment is arranged on, in length and breadth tensile strength > 10KN/m;
Cement stabilizing layer, further comprises lower stabilized zone 51 and upper stabilized zone 52, and the lower thickness of stabilized zone 51 is 30 centimetres, water Cement content is 4%, and the upper thickness of stabilized zone 52 is 20 centimetres, and cement content is 6%;
Emulsification pitch penetration 6, Asphalt emulsion content is 0.7 ~ 1.1kg/m2
Bituminous concrete moxture layer 7, thickness is 9 millimeters.
Wherein, surface layer 1 is arranged on bituminous concrete moxture layer 7.

Again as shown in figure 4, the embodiment of the present invention three provides a kind of internal car noise method of testing, including:
Step S41 is there is provided a kind of internal car noise test bad road, and the road surface includes the surface layer that thickness is 120 millimeters, the surface layer Including by weight 2:1 ratio is mixed, particle diameter is respectively filled with modified drip between the building stones of 25 millimeters and 20 millimeters, building stones It is blue or green;
Step S42, carries out test preparation;
Step S43, test vehicle is at the uniform velocity travelled with 40km/h speed on test road surface;
Noise data and handled in step S44, collecting vehicle.
In step S41, the voidage of surface layer is 8.5%, and construction depth is 10.24 millimeters.It is laid in addition, considering This and test are facilitated, and the test road surfacing width of the present embodiment is 3 meters, and laying length is 80 ~ 100 meters, preferably 100 meters.
Step S42 is then similar to existing method of testing, relates generally to test condition and the confirmation of test vehicle, test equipment standard It is standby with installing etc., be illustrated below:
(1)Confirm that meteorological condition is good, the bad weather such as no rain, snow, hail, earth's surface above 1.2m height wind speed peak value is not More than 5m/s, the not super many 3m/s of mean wind speed in 10s, environment temperature is at -5 DEG C~38 DEG C;
(2)Confirm that ambient noise meets test request, the noise being made up of ambient noise and tester internal sound should At least below tested sound 10dB (A);
(3)Exact p-value vehicle meets entire vehicle design requirement, and bodywork surface is clean and tidy, without other foreign matters, spare tyre, driver's tool Fixed, test vehicle all liq medium includes coolant, brake fluid, lubricating oil, power steering fluid and added by design requirement Note, fuel filling is to mailbox volume more than 1/4, vehicle at least break-in 1500km;
(4)All service conditions of engine, such as fuel, lubricating oil, ignition timing or injection time all should comply with Current vehicle technical conditions, engine should be stablized in normal operating temperature range(About 90 DEG C);
(5)Tire pressure has to comply with vehicle technical conditions, and tire should be relatively new, and decorative pattern is without noticeable wear(Should not particularly There is eccentric wear);
(6)The primary condition of car load should comply with 4.4 or 4.6 regulation in GB/T3730.2-1996, and in-car is removed Outside driver, tester and test equipment, other staff are not sat or other articles should not be placed.Opening, it is such as skylight, all Vehicle window, air-conditioning inner-outer circulation mouthful, it is necessary to shut;Servicing unit, such as wiper, heater, fan and air-conditioning, It must not be worked in measurement process of the test;Adjustable seat should adjust design point;
(7)Test equipment is installed, test equipment quantity and parameter specification must not be less than following table:
(8)Measuring point is selected:As shown in figure 5, microphone is arranged in figure 1.~8. position, wherein front-seat from operator seat from a left side To right arrangement measuring point 1.~4., heel row arrange from left to right measuring point 5.~8., at least arrange 2., 7. two measuring points;
(9)Software parameters are set, from CPB analysis modes, and frequency analysis scope is 20Hz-10kHz, and average mode is line Property, time 10s;
(10)Calibrate microphone.
Because step S41 provides a kind of novel test bad road, roughness between coarse road and durable road, when vehicle with Middle low speed(Such as 40km/h)At the uniform velocity travel, can just evoke within in-car low-frequency noise, particularly 200Hz on bad road herein Construct noise, therefore, in step S43, test vehicle is at the uniform velocity travelled with 40km/h speed on test road surface, you can real Internal car noise test of the existing the present embodiment under bad road.Analyzed, can be very good really with reference to the structural frequency response of vehicle chassis Determine noise source, and guidance is provided with examining for rectification scheme.In order to reduce influence of the engine noise to internal car noise, shelves as far as possible Select the most high-grade of energy steady operation in position.
As step S42, step S44 is also similar to existing method of testing, is only briefly described as follows herein:
(1)To ensure measurement accuracy, before formal gathered data, it should be adjusted using the automatic gain function of data collecting system The range ability of whole each passage, makes signal scale be in 3/4 or so of full scale scale;
(2)Record three groups of preferable data of uniformity(Conformance definition:Sound pressure level total value and spectrum curve difference are no more than 2dB(A);
(3)The uniformity of data is checked again, and one group of data in choosing three data reclaimed waters in normal times are handled, and are remembered Record corresponding sound pressure level and lamprophonia degrees of data.
